for everyone who heard static, this might explain it:

from YouTwo.net

Irish DJ Dave Fanning premiered U2's new single "Electrical Storm" on 2FM this evening. 2FM's RealAudio
webcast was purposely interrupted while the song was being played to prevent an electronic capture of
the recording, leaving thousands of online listeners disappointed. UK listeners who heard the radio broadcast
report that the version Fanning played is different than the version Radio 1 played last Sunday.

Actually, there's only two versions that have been widely released. The third version (the one w/out the glockenspiel) is just the single version without the "left channel." Somehow the William Orbit version, which is in fact on the promo cd sent to the radio stations, hasn't been released as an mp3.
